No media: "✈️ Jas 39 Gripen aircraft for Ukraine During the visit , Zelenskyi announced that Ukrainian pilots had begun "test trials of Swedish Grippen aircraft." What was meant by "test" in terms of "flight" or "simulator", or the president was mistaken and meant "theoretical familiarization" - it is not clear. Because both the simulator and the final stage "the required number of hours in the air" take place after a long 6- or 3-month (abbreviated) theoretical training. The fact that Zelensky was not mistaken in the wording can be indicated by a chain of facts: At the beginning of 2023, information appeared on the Internet that Ukraine is interested in the Swedish Gripen as an analogue of the F-16 due to the problem of take-off infrastructure (Swedish planes are less demanding). ➡️ On May 25, 2023, the Swedish Prime Minister announced that Ukrainian pilots will be allowed to train on Gripen aircraft. ➡️ On June 16, the 12th package of military aid to Ukraine included additional funds for Gripen aircraft training . I emphasize "additional funds". ➡️ August 19 — Zelenskyi announces "test trials" by Ukrainian pilots. So, "hypothetically" Ukrainian pilots had 2.5-3 months and allocated funding for training. That is, "theoretically" the pilots had the opportunity to pass the "theoretical stage". In fact, everything looks quite logical: while Ukraine needs time to prepare the infrastructure for the F-16 and build an echeloned air defense system (which we are still waiting for) around it, the needs should be covered as soon as possible by the less demanding Gripen, which, moreover, will be one of the elements of the echeloned air defense system around F-16 bases. The opinion that Gripen aircraft will appear faster than F-16 is confirmed by yesterday's interview of the commander of the Armed Forces of the Ukrainian Armed Forces M. Oleshchuk where he stated that the 2023 class is being sent for F-16 training, and the 2016 class for Gripen training. pilots with combat experience. That is, it indirectly indicates the priority of Gripen's appearance in Ukrainian skies."

According to Deputy Defense Minister Anna Malyar, the AFU had success in the direction southeast of Rabotino and south of Malaya Tokmachka in Zaporizhzhya Region. The American Institute for the Study of War, citing geolocation images, claims that our defenders have advanced east of Robotyno in Zaporizhzhia. Russian bloggers also began to report almost the loss of Robotyne. However, official Ukrainian spokespersons have not yet confirmed the success of the Ukrainian Armed Forces in this area of the front. |

" The Telegraph investigators found out (https://www.telegraph.co.uk/world-ne...tals-xi-putin/) that China is arming Russia with helicopters, drones, optical sights and materials for the defense industry. Exports of potential military goods from China to Russia have tripled compared to last year. This year's trade between the two countries is expected to exceed $200 billion. Earlier, Politico wrote (https://www.politico.eu/article/chin...hanghai-h-win/) that China has significantly increased its dual-use trade with Russia over the past year, which has helped Moscow, in particular, import sanctioned Western technologies. Russia has imported more than $100 million worth of drones from China - 30 times more than Ukraine." The people that need to see this won't but I'm still posting it for those that aren't banned.
